Output 74de581969e215022a293cb4b13ab2a3477d75b8d390c21a564807f9338e0217:2

value
881590
script pubkey
OP_0 OP_PUSHBYTES_20 1fc0f3687d7b246c957c225a11ec9ea25e576704
address
bc1qrlq0x6ra0vjxe9tuyfdprmy75f09wecyk0sru8
transaction
74de581969e215022a293cb4b13ab2a3477d75b8d390c21a564807f9338e0217
confirmations
215202
spent
true